Take it easy on a rail holiday to Venice, stopping overnight in some stunning places en route, with shorter journeys and as few changes as possible. Hop across to Paris by Eurostar, then travel via Lake Geneva and the Simplon route to Venice, with a journey back via Innsbruck and the Brenner Pass.
From £1,699 per person // 10 days
Discover the beautiful Slovenian resort of Lake Bled, surrounded by the soaring peaks of the Julian Alps, with rail travel to and from your destination. Spend nights en route in Strasbourg and Verona on the way and then return via Vienna where you'll catch a comfortable sleeper train back to meet the Eurostar.
From £1,199 per person // 8 days
Enjoy a rail journey into the beautiful and fascinating region of Tyrol, straddling Austria, Germany and Italy, on this relaxing holiday. You'll have stops in Tyrolean capital Innsbruck, the pretty towns of Merano and Bressanone as well as East Tyrolean capital Lienz before heading home via Munich.
From £1,849 per person // 12 days
Enjoy four days at leisure to explore the beautifully situated city of Cape Town. Then board the iconic Blue Train for an unforgettable journey through the landscapes of South Africa to Pretoria, with a stop at Kimberley Diamond Mines along the way.
From £3,699 per person // 9 days
